I'd imagine he called it a completely different car because it is. His hardtop is a R56 S and his loaner is a convertible R53 Cooper. They have completely different engines, suspensions, chassis and bodies. The R56 convertible isn't out till the beginning of next year. gemgirlpa you're genuinely scaring me, you are aware that the convertible you bought is a totally different (earlier) version of the MINI than the hardtop currently available right?
